Judgment sampling, also referred to as judgmental sampling or authoritative sampling, is a non-probability sampling technique where the researcher selects units to be sampled based on his own existing knowledge, or his professional judgment. Because of the selection criteria used in assembling the group, the judgment sample is not random, and the conclusions drawn from research on such a sample do not have broad applicability to the larger community.
